Competition cancellation-No refund. Neg. Coggins certificate required within 12 months and out-of-state horses also require health certificate. CCI4/3 ForeignHorses must be in possession of an FEI Passport. CCI4 U.S. Horses must be in possession of an FEI Passport. CCI3 U.S. Horses may have either a FEI Passport or a USEF National Passport. All passports must contain proof of vaccination against influenza, signed by a veterinarian in accordance with FEI rules.All riders and horses must be registered with the FEI. Refer to FEI website www.horsesport.org for FEI qualifications and requirements. Substitutions accepted up to May 6th.

Sampling Procedure for Prohibited Substances (Vet Regs, Ch. V&VI and Annex IV) Regular sampling is carried out in CCI 4/3*, CCIOs, World Cup Qualifiers and Finals, Championships and Games, whereas at other CCIs sampling is recommended. When testing takes place, the number of horses tested is at the discretion of the Testing Veterinarian/Veterinary Delegate; however, a minimum of three is recommended (Vet Reg. Art. 1016).
